Broadfield UK is seeking a Corporate Lawyer with a minimum of 1-3 years PQE to join our Southampton office, offering a competitive salary of £60k to £70k plus a best in class bonus incentive scheme. As a law firm dedicated to serving mid-market clients, Broadfield UK combines deep expertise across multiple practice areas with a strong commitment to client service. Our Corporate & Commercial team works across various sectors, advising UK and international clients, from fast-growing start-ups to listed companies. The team, comprised of entrepreneurial experts, fosters a friendly and collegiate culture while delivering high-quality work comparable to that of large city firms.

In this role, you will assist and advise on all aspects of company law, including:

  • Private company mergers and acquisitions
  • Private equity transactions, MBOs, and MBIs
  • Joint ventures and investor/shareholders’ agreements
  • Articles of association and other constitutional documents
  • Demergers, company reconstructions, and reorganisations

Additionally, you will have the opportunity to engage in AIM flotations, takeovers, commercial lending, and the financing and refinancing of businesses. Our corporate team represents a diverse range of clients, including acquirers, private equity and VCT funds, founders/sellers, management teams, and funders, and has historically been involved in significant deals in the Solent and Thames Valley region.

We welcome candidates relocating to the area, those looking to move laterally from a national or large regional firm, or those eager to work on larger transactions.

Qualifications include:

  • Admissions to the Solicitor Roll
  • A 2:1 degree or higher preferred
  • Must have a minimum of 1 to 3 years PQE in a corporate team, with confidence in handling the full range of corporate processes
